@nodejs_ru

Страница 2702 из 2748
Varyen
18.10.2018
09:00:17
ладно, всем спасибо :)

Ann
18.10.2018
09:16:00
Штооо, нохрена тут свич вообще
задание такое было, реализовать много блоков через свич и ifelse

Eugene
18.10.2018
09:30:19
ну вот у меня на проде самая полная версия ньюрелика мониторит - и там ничего такого нет
вообще да, прям код никто профилировать не собирается в нюрелик, но он хорошо так дает аналитику по вызовам эндпоинтов, и если в проекте нормально сделаны эндпоинты (каждый за свое, а не один на все), и если шаришь по проекту, загибы на конкретных запросах могут сказать о многом.

Евгений
18.10.2018
09:33:49
http://prntscr.com/l7gg1t посоны обезательно пушить по SSH ? или можно вполне нормально работать и по HTTPS ? в чем отличие вообше ?

Google
Евгений
18.10.2018
09:35:11
По SSH работает авторизация по ключу
вобшем если на команду настраивать то нада по SSH ?

Евгений
18.10.2018
09:36:49
Необязательно
ну вообшем по вот этим данным может вся команда запушивать и скачивать ? http://prntscr.com/l7gk7e

Alexander
18.10.2018
09:41:58
Eugene
18.10.2018
09:42:17
Дай доступ, проверим можно ли по ним пушить

Alexander
18.10.2018
09:42:45
Grigorii
18.10.2018
09:42:46
у меня семерка
там есть стандартное ПО - называется ножницы

Shift+win+s
Это ж только в 10-ке появилось, и то в новой

Google
Alexander
18.10.2018
09:43:20
С висты вроде ещё

Евгений
18.10.2018
09:43:38
Shift+win+s
не скриншотит так

Arthur
18.10.2018
09:43:45
на 8 не работает)

Grigorii
18.10.2018
09:43:53
не скриншотит так
Попробуй ножницы

Arthur
18.10.2018
09:44:15
зато классический Prt Scr и Ctrl+V пашет)

Grigorii
18.10.2018
09:44:27
Только не FullPage Screen

Alexander
18.10.2018
09:45:03
https://www.digitalcitizen.life/4-ways-take-screenshots-windows-8-81-using-built-tools

Eugene
18.10.2018
10:35:43
Всем привет Юзаю папетир. Можно ли запустить хромиум при старте приложения, поддерживать его живым и использовать этот инстанс, дабы ускорить время выполнения запроса, убрав запуск браузера каждый раз заново?
Еще раз привет, норм ли так создание одного инстанса браузера const pptr = require('puppeteer'); let instance = null; module.exports.get_browser_instance = async function () { if (!instance) { instance = await pptr.launch({ args: ['--no-sandbox'], dumpio: true }); } return instance; }; в индексе (async function run_browser() { await get_browser_instance(); /** launch browser on app init */ }()); и этот инстанс уже юзать в конкретных местах уже вроде работает, если есть замечания - буду рад услышать

Artyom
18.10.2018
11:15:57
https://github.com/denysdovhan/awesome-nodeschool

Eugene
18.10.2018
11:17:31
Про стрелочные слыхал?
Замечания по сути

Alexander
18.10.2018
11:18:38
Замечания по сути
Ладно, зачем тебе там переменная instance?

Просто возвращай ее себе в код сразу, твой launch

Google
Alexander
18.10.2018
11:22:29
Я вообще с puppeteer наигрался в свое время, обращался из вне файла к запущенной странице уже в браузере

Было весело

Роман
18.10.2018
11:23:26
так а разве тогда не будет каждый раз launch заново срабатывать
Изначально, как я понял, тебе нужен был один запущенный интсанс, и к нему уже будут цепляться другие скрипты, чтобы не запускать каждый раз новый браузер. А сейчас ты просто внутри одного скрипта инициализируешь инстанс и используешь его. Так и задумано или ты думаешь что запустив второй скрипт, он подцепится к тому же браузеру (так не будет)?

Eugene
18.10.2018
11:28:33
Изначально, как я понял, тебе нужен был один запущенный интсанс, и к нему уже будут цепляться другие скрипты, чтобы не запускать каждый раз новый браузер. А сейчас ты просто внутри одного скрипта инициализируешь инстанс и используешь его. Так и задумано или ты думаешь что запустив второй скрипт, он подцепится к тому же браузеру (так не будет)?
Сейчас у меня есть эта ф-ция, которую я раню при старте, она поднимает инстанс браузера по запросу с фронта, я обращаюсь к той же ф-ции, которая мне отдает уже запущенный инстанс и с этим же браузером я работаю идея такая была по крайне мере

по логам я вижу, что на запросе браузер не поднимается заново только при старте приложения

вроде именно то, что надо может я чего-то не понял, конечно

Роман
18.10.2018
11:30:22
ну если всё внутри одного процесса, то да. Я изначально не так задачу понял значит.

Eugene
18.10.2018
11:30:49
да-да процесс один, одно приложение норм так, получается?

Дмитрий
18.10.2018
11:33:16
Один народ, один процесс 0/

Eugene
18.10.2018
11:33:21
Сори, если плохо обьяснил задачу Проблема была изначально в том, что иногда хромиум так долго запускался, что в итоге таймаут срабатывал А иногда отрабатывал за секунду Вот эта оптимизация должна решить проблему

Дмитрий
18.10.2018
11:34:07
У puppeteer есть не только launch

Alexander
18.10.2018
11:34:17
Дмитрий
18.10.2018
11:34:50
connect или что то в этом духе, чтобы подключаться к указанному уже запущенному инстансу

Но гугл как обычно не умеет в продукты и у меня всё глючило, подробнее вникнуть не удалось

Alexander
18.10.2018
11:36:03
https://github.com/GoogleChrome/puppeteer/blob/v1.9.0/docs/api.md#puppeteerconnectoptions

це?

Eugene
18.10.2018
11:36:46
Всем спасибо за помощь))

Дмитрий
18.10.2018
11:36:59
це?
ага

Alexander
18.10.2018
11:37:04
Всем спасибо за помощь))
погодь, ща вкину как я это сделал

Google
Dmitry
18.10.2018
11:37:18
Когда V8 выполняет js код, он его перегоняет в C++?

Alexander
18.10.2018
11:37:30
вот, т.е. обращается к уже запущеной странице в браузере https://github.com/ejnshtein/vk-to-telegram/blob/master/lib/audio-parser.js

в байткод же

Дмитрий
18.10.2018
11:38:34
У него огромный пайплайн, оба утверждения не верны по сути)

Роман
18.10.2018
11:38:40
Роман
18.10.2018
11:41:12
connect или что то в этом духе, чтобы подключаться к указанному уже запущенному инстансу
Так запускай его с параметром --remote-debugging-port=port и цепляешься к нему из других скриптов ко всему браузеру или к отдельным страницам. Либо browser.wsEndpoint() и по нему.

Alexander
18.10.2018
11:42:19
я ща подумал что можно делать самовызывающуюся функцию и ее экспортить уже с методами для получения инстанца...

Undefined
18.10.2018
11:51:57
Доброго времени суток Кто-нибудь пользовался nodemailer, nodemailer-outlook с авторизацией через организации?

Страница 2702 из 2748